The Condottiero War Hammer was a warhammer obtainable during the Italian Renaissance.

History

Monteriggioni

The Assassin Ezio Auditore was first able to obtain this hammer after he had collected 50 feathers for his mother, Maria Auditore da Firenze. When the task was accomplished, his uncle Mario informed him that the weapon was available for purchase at Monteriggioni's blacksmith.

Rome

In Rome, Ezio could find the hammer available at any blacksmith during the 16th century.

Constanstinople

In Constanstinople, the game lists it as the Prussian War Hammer
